ATI Capstone Pharmacology
a nurse is caring for a client who is receiving morphine, what assessment is priority
Correct Answer: RR

a nurse is assessing a client who has been using beclomethasone for 2 weeks to
manage her asthma, what is the priority to report to the provider Correct Answer:
bronchospasms

a nurse is caring for a client who has prescription for terazosin, the nurse should
identify that this medication is indicated for which of the following disorders?
Correct Answer: hypertension
BPH

a nurse is providing teaching to a client who has a new prescription for
beclomethasone inhaler to use with an albuterol inhaler for asthma maintenance,
what should the nurse instruct? Correct Answer: you should gargle with water
after each use of this inhaler

a nurse is preparing to administer topotecan IV, which of the following meds
should the nurse expect to administer to control the adverse effects Correct
Answer: granisetron

(antiemetic to prevent n/v) for clients receiving chemo

a nurse is planning a staff education session on AE of meds, what info should the
nurse discuss about anticholinergic adverse effects? Correct Answer: blurred
vision
tachycardia
constipation

a nurse is providing teaching to a client who has a new prescription for
guaifenesin, what info regarding the action of guaifenesin should the nurse include
in the teaching? Correct Answer: guaifenesin increases cough production

a nurse is preparing to administer verapamil to a client who is 2 days
postmyocardial infarction. the nurse should monitor the client for which of the

, following outcomes as therapeutic response to the medication? Correct Answer:
decreased anginal pain

a nurse is providing teaching to a client who has a new prescription for
levothyroxine, which statement indicates understanding of the teaching? Correct
Answer: "i might not realize the full effect of the medication for several weeks"

take on empty stomach with glass of water, first thing in the morning 30-60min
prior to breakfast

a nurse is assessing a client who has HF is taking digoxin. the nurse should
monitor the client for which of the following manifestations as an indication of
digoxin toxicity to report to the provider? Correct Answer: vomiting

(n/v, anorexia, blurred vision)

a nurse is providing teaching for a pt with a prescription for oral metronidazole,
what is the priority teaching point? Correct Answer: you should report a rash to
your provider

(fatal disorder Stevens-Johnson syndrome)

a nurse is providing discharge instructions to a client who has a new prescription
for codeine for cough suppression, what is the priority instruction? Correct
Answer: move slowly when standing from a lying down position

(r/f orthostatic hypotension)

a nurse is reviewing the medical record of a client who received his medications 1
hour ago, the pt reports chest pain, this can be an AE of what med? Correct
Answer: albuterol

(beta2agonist, controls bronchospasm for asthma--can cause tremors, chest pain,
tachycardia, dysrhythmias)

a nurse is teaching a pt who has a new prescription for brimonidine to treat open-
angle glaucoma, what indicates an understanding of the instructions? Correct
Answer: i can expect to feel some irritation when i put these drops in my eyes
